Ticket: Undo/redo stack desync in Sketchloom

Quick one for the sync: when you undo a node resize and then redo it, the connector anchors snap back to stale coordinates. Looks like the redo buffer isn't capturing the layout pass we added in the Fernbrook release. Fix is ready on a branch — it serializes anchor state into each history frame. Small perf cost, nothing scary. Before we merge, we need sign-off since it touches the history format. Approval goes to the following person.

signatory, yagap-bawig: Ulaath Eliath

## Idempotency Keys for Payment Retries (Lumopay)

Every retry of a charge request must reuse the original idempotency key; generating a new key on retry can produce duplicate charges. Keys are scoped per merchant and expire after 48 hours. Reviewers should verify keys are derived server-side, never from client input. The full key-generation specification and threat model are maintained on the internal page.

dashboard of kaguf-tawip = https://vault.merlaqsys.test/issue

## Service Accounts — StormFan Alert Fan-Out

The fan-out worker authenticates to the internal dispatch tier using the svc-stormfan account. Rotate quarterly; scopes are limited to publish-only on alert topics. If deliveries stall during your shift, verify the worker is using the current credential, reproduced below for reference.

API key for kaweg-hahif: kto4_rAjZ

## Tuning — Post-incident cache settings (Ferrowick catalog service)

After the stale-cache incident, where price entries survived 14 hours past their intended lifetime due to a TTL unit mismatch, we consolidated all cache tuning into one place so on-call can audit it quickly. TTLs are now expressed in seconds everywhere, negative-lookup caching is capped separately, and the invalidation fanout has an explicit retry budget. If you change any of these during an incident, note it in the handoff log. Current values are listed below.

constants for tafop-bahip:
TIERS = {
    "druok": 637,
    "jordor": 822,
    "fraiel": 315,
    "kasdor": 990,
    "rusok": 822,
    "zorius": 793,
    "aldael": 282,
}